As nouns the difference between sobriety and stability

is that sobriety is the quality or state of being sober while stability is the condition of being stable or in equilibrium, and thus resistant to change.

sobriety

English

Noun

(-)
  • The quality or state of being sober.
  • The quality or state of not being intoxicated.
  • The quality or state of being grave or earnestly thoughtful.
  • The state or quality of being unhurried; a state of calm.
  • A state of moderation or seriousness.
  • A state of modest in color or style.
  • Soundness of judgement.
